Bitcoin's correlation to the S&P 500 has held at record levels over the past three days, according to data from Coin Metrics.

The measurement that tracks the relationship between two assets — realized correlation — hit 0.367 on Thursday, July 9. While this isn't an especially high correlation value, the monthly realized correlation between Bitcoin and the S&P 500 hit 0.79 on Wednesday, July 8. 

Kevin Kelly, former equity analyst at Bloomberg and co-founder of cryptocurrency research firm Delphi Digital, said that higher correlations to traditional assets are an indicator that crypto assets are maturing in an interview with Coindesk. He predicted that the trend will continue.
